Alan Pardew: 'Arsenal are better with Alex Oxlade-Chamberlain'

Pardew: 'Arsenal are better with Oxlade-Chamberlain'

Crystal Palace manager Alan Pardew believes that Arsenal are a better side when Alex Oxlade-Chamberlain plays.

Pardew gave the England international his senior debut during their time at Southampton together back in 2010, and the Eagles boss talked up his former player's ability to Sky Sports News.

"I look at Arsenal and they're a much better team with him in it," said Pardew. "He's got great pace and quality and he'd be a massive asset for England if he could stay fit.

"I feel so sorry for him because he's had such bad luck with injuries."

Oxlade-Chamberlain joined Arsenal from Southampton in 2011, for a fee of around £12m.
